Comics Which Contain This StoryNo comics so far CharactersNo characters mentioned in this story. Story SynopsisThe story opens with Usagi traveling on a crowded road. He asks a man eating a meal under a tree just off the roadway where an apparently little-used path leads. The path leads in the direction Usagi wants to go, but the man warns it is ?Better to stick to the main road, samurai.? However, Usagi is in a hurry to return to Sanshobo?s temple, so he takes the path. Some time later, Usagi is alone on the path, somewhere within a forest, and spiders are seen crawling all over the trees and onto the path. Usagi is oblivious to them until he feels them scurrying atop his hat. Usagi is then shocked at the vast number of spiders. He follows a tokage?s terrified ?Yeek! Yeek!? and finds it trapped within a large mass of spider webs. After helping the tokage to escape, he spots someone?s corpse hanging in sheets of webbing spread across a tree. Usagi decides it is time to hurry on. A while later, Usagi emerges from the forest and enters a small town, which is crawling with spiders. Usagi makes his way to an inn, where Usagi comments to those inside ?You sure have a lot spiders around your town.? The serving girl relates they started showing up about a week past and are ?everywhere,? but they simply regard them as an annoyance. However, after Usagi tells the girl of the dead body in the spider webs near the town, panic ensues and nearly all of the inn?s patrons depart hurriedly to barricade their homes against the spiders. At this point, a mysterious ronin, Sasuke, introduces himself to Usagi and invites him to sit with him for a drink. Usagi and Sasuke exchange information on their routes into the village and how both are infested with the spiders. Sasuke comments, ?They have us trapped here,? but Usagi does not think the spiders capable of such an intelligent act. Sasuke takes his leave, saying he will soon see Usagi again since they cannot go very far. That night, while sleeping, Usagi is bitten on the forehead by a spider. He then hears the sound of a large crash and screaming coming from below his room in the inn. He rushes down to find a large section of the inn wall broken open, and the innkeeper exclaims his daughter is missing and implores for Usagi to help. The innkeeper believes brigands have taken his daughter, and Usagi tells him to round up some volunteers to help track down the brigands. As Usagi inspects the large hole in the wall, Sasuke arrives and states spiders are the culprits. At first Usagi thinks he is being ridiculous, but slowly he seems to be convinced, though the villagers who come to help are not and think they are being made fools of as they follow the trail of huge ?spider tracks? out of the village. That changes when the group is attacked by a huge spider goblin. The spider goblin is defeated, but the villagers run screaming back to town. A short while later, Sasuke and a very nervous Usagi reach the entrance to a cave that emits ?the stench of Evil.? Inside the cave, Sasuke reveals himself to be some sort of sorcerer as he lights their way with a magical ball of light. Usagi is even more shaken by this knowledge, but continues to follow Sasuke to help save the abducted girl. Finally the girl is found trapped within large sheets of spider webs. However, before she can be rescued from them, the Kumo-Onna (spider woman) and her horde of giant spiders attack. It seems the Kumo-Onna and Sasuke are familiar with each other. Sasuke summons a giant frog, freaking out Usagi even further, and then the battle is on. During the battle, while coming to Sasuke?s aid, Usagi is hit by venom spit by Kumo-Onna, and he collapses, feeling his body ?wasting away.? In the end, however, Kumo-Onna is defeated as Sasuke?s giant frog devours her. The scene switches back to the inn, where Usagi awakens to find three days have passed. In turns out Sasuke brought both the innkeeper?s daughter (the serving girl) and Usagi back to town on the back of the giant frog, and Sasuke gave Usagi herbs that restored his health. Sasuke left the day before Usagi awakened to take care of ?some trouble up north? and the spiders are also all gone. With a hard look in his eyes, Usagi hopes to never meet up with Sasuke again.
